BlueZone licensing

Starting with BlueZone Version 7.1, a new method has been implemented for controlling BlueZone licenses.

Note: Existing BlueZone customers: The new BlueZone License file (BlueZone.lic) is required to be used by existing BlueZone customers who are upgrading to BlueZone Web-to-Host version 7.1 or later. If you choose to keep your existing pre-7.1 installation, you must continue to use the old BlueZone licensing scheme on your pre-7.1 installation.

As mentioned above, the new licensing method requires the use of a BlueZone License file (BlueZone.lic). This file is required to activate your BlueZone license. Without a valid BlueZone License file, BlueZone emulation sessions will start, but will not connect to a host.

Note: A BlueZone License file is required for both evaluations and licensed installations of BlueZone Web-to-Host.
